Transaction f705331fa4a0c34b510262587c8d592c0904063a98229fe6c58893265b76472d
1 Input
1 Output
-
f705331fa4a0c34b510262587c8d592c0904063a98229fe6c58893265b76472d:0
- value
- 193337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e4b34daf24a46b0326e0422b6692aa3ca68b90b OP_EQUAL
- address
- 3QsbehsgFDB5cp3eCF2ScUhsQSBoJ14DHc